9 ALICE Si-FMD,T0,V0 26/11 2002Jens Jørgen Gaardhøje, NBI, gardhoje@nbi.dk9 Heat dissipation. Si-FMD Heat dissipated by FE electronics of one Si detector ring: VA1TA preamp chip (128 channels): 150 mW  80 chips = 12 W / ring For simulation: assume uniform distribution on hybrid surface (towards support plate) Read-out electronics and power distribution:  5 W / ring For simulation: assume concentrated in 2 locations near outer radius => Total estimated heat release pr. side < 30-40 W
